Hey guys.... just to let you know my 360 pc case is comming around and will have a tut on how to do it soon!!! I have purchased a WD 1TB MY BOOK Drive which is awsome..... I ripped a dvd onto it to try it out and my xbox says there are no video file on the drive!!!!! What type of file do I have to have to watch my movies......? PLEASE HELP!!!!!

Mp4, Xvid files like that is what it has to be u could convert it to them i use a program called xilisoft video converter u have to pay for that program but there is some out there that are free. if it is already like that then go log onto xbox live and go to market place and then game addon then select the "O" category and select optional media update. Then Try it. Also here is a link to another topic with all that will play on the xbox 360: http://www.360-hq.com/postt2628.html its not a full list but getting there.

you could try this program which can covert dvds 2 avi files (divx/xvid) for the xbox 360..
http://www.xbox-hq.com/html/download-file-526.html

I have no need to convert files.. Most everthing i have is in XVID or the latest DIVX codec.. you could also install TVERSITY.com media server on your pc which can transcode any files to the right format and will be available in your videos tab.
